Takahiro Yasui is a urological surgeon and researcher whose work sits at the intersection of robotic-assisted surgery, minimally invasive techniques, and urological oncology. Based primarily in Japan, Yasui has made substantial contributions to advancing the precision and outcomes of robot-assisted radical prostatectomy (RARP), with seminal investigations into how pelvic anatomical features—including membranous urethral length and pelvic floor morphology—influence early urinary continence recovery post-surgery. His comparative analyses of Retzius-sparing versus conventional RARP approaches and transperitoneal versus extraperitoneal techniques have helped refine surgical decision-making for prostate cancer patients. Equally notable is Yasui's pioneering work in robotic-assisted renal access for percutaneous nephrolithotomy. His randomized clinical trial comparing robotic-assisted fluoroscopic-guided and ultrasound-guided renal puncture—his most cited work with 33 citations—has helped establish a rigorous evidence base for emerging robotic guidance technologies in stone surgery. His phantom model studies further demonstrate a methodical translational approach. Contributing also to national-level surgical data through Japan's National Clinical Database, Yasui's research spans bench to bedside, making him an influential voice in contemporary urological surgery and surgical innovation across both adult and pediatric populations.
